Podfics - I've had two of my fics podficced and it's a pretty cool experience, listening to someone read your fic. You can do a straight read, or go crazy with character voices and soundtracks and stuff. I think you can also go outside the box with this quite easily - dramatic readings, reading a fic in another language (I feel that whether you speak that other language or not is irrelevant, so long as the product is amazing to listen to). If it's a fic that could use some laughs, make it funnier by reading it in Enochian. Or you could take your favourite scene and read it like it's beat poetry. Bribe some friends into helping you turn a scene into a radio play. Record the fic as if William Shatner is reading it. Read the fic backwards and then lay the track down over some funky beats, and you could have next summer's dance hit.
